The Science of Protein Utilization

Proteins are macromolecules composed of amino acids, which are the fundamental units of life. Of the 20 standard amino acids, nine are classified as essential (EAAs): histidine, isoleucine, leucine, lysine, methionine, phenylalanine, threonine, tryptophan, and valine. These EAAs cannot be synthesized by the human body and must be obtained through dietary intake. They are indispensable for a multitude of biological functions, including muscle protein synthesis (MPS), enzyme and hormone production, neurotransmitter synthesis, immune system function, and tissue repair and regeneration. The efficiency with which the body utilizes ingested protein and amino acids is critical for maintaining optimal health and performance.

Traditional protein sources, such as whey, casein, or plant-based proteins, require extensive digestion to break down intact protein structures into individual amino acids and small peptides. This digestive process is energy-intensive and can be inefficient, especially in individuals with compromised digestive function or older adults whose enzymatic activity may be diminished. Furthermore, a significant portion of ingested protein is often metabolized for energy or converted into glucose, rather than being directed towards anabolism. This results in a higher nitrogenous waste load on the kidneys and a suboptimal net protein utilization (NPU) or biological value (BV), which are measures of how efficiently the body uses dietary protein for growth and maintenance.

Essential amino acid supplementation emerged as a more direct method to deliver the necessary building blocks for protein synthesis, bypassing some digestive steps. However, not all EAA supplements are created equal. An "essential amino acid supplement alternative," often referred to as an advanced amino formula, differentiates itself through specific formulations designed for enhanced efficacy. These advanced formulas typically utilize free-form amino acids, which are not bound in peptide chains, allowing for rapid and direct absorption into the bloodstream. This circumvents the slower digestion rates of whole proteins, leading to a much faster spike in plasma amino acid levels, a critical factor for stimulating MPS. Research indicates that the specific ratios of EAAs are paramount, particularly the branched-chain amino acids (BCAAs) – leucine, isoleucine, and valine – with leucine often considered the primary anabolic trigger.

Benefits for Seniors

The aging population faces unique physiological challenges that make advanced amino formulas particularly beneficial. Sarcopenia, the age-related loss of muscle mass, strength, and function, is a prevalent and debilitating condition affecting a significant portion of older adults. This decline in muscle mass is often exacerbated by "anabolic resistance," a phenomenon where older muscles require a higher threshold of amino acids to stimulate muscle protein synthesis compared to younger muscles.

Q2: How does an advanced amino formula differ from traditional protein powder?
A2: The primary difference lies in digestion and absorption. Protein powders (e.g., whey, casein) contain intact protein chains that require digestion into amino acids before absorption. Advanced amino formulas consist of free-form amino acids, which are readily absorbed into the bloodstream. This leads to faster protein synthesis stimulation, a lower caloric load, and minimal digestive burden compared to traditional protein powders. They are not meal replacements but highly efficient anabolic signals.

Q3: Are there any side effects associated with essential amino acid alternatives?
A3: When taken within recommended dosages, advanced EAA formulas are generally well-tolerated. Side effects are rare but can include mild gastrointestinal discomfort (e.g., stomach upset) in sensitive individuals, especially with very high doses. It's crucial to adhere to dosage guidelines. Individuals with kidney or liver conditions should consult a healthcare professional before use, as excessive protein or amino acid intake can place additional strain on these organs.
